This study was conducted to examine the problem that students’ mathematical critical thinking skills remain varied and are assumed to be influenced by their mathematical disposition. Therefore, this research aims to describe students’ mathematical critical thinking skills from the perspective of their mathematical disposition. This research employed a qualitative approach with a descriptive design. The subjects were six eighth-grade students from SMP IT Al-Marjan Bengkulu, categorized into high, medium, and low levels of mathematical disposition. Data were collected through a mathematical disposition questionnaire, a mathematical critical thinking skills test, and semi-structured interviews. Data were analyzed through data reduction, data display, and conclusion drawing. The findings indicate that students with high mathematical disposition demonstrate strong performance across all critical thinking indicators, including interpretation, analysis, evaluation, inference, and explanation. Students with medium disposition show adequate ability but lack consistency in drawing conclusions and providing logical justification. Meanwhile, students with low mathematical disposition tend to rely on procedural strategies rather than developing deeper conceptual understanding. These results confirm that mathematical disposition contributes to the quality of students’ critical thinking in mathematics.
